D000073196Level 4
Integrative Oncology
**Definition:** These evidence-based therapies to reduce symptoms associated with treatment of cancer.
**Tree numbers:** - E02.190.463
GET
/api/v1/systems/mesh/nodes/D000073196Hierarchy Explorer
Loading...
Cross-system equivalences0
No cross-system equivalences mapped for this node.